| Background: Hepatic toxicity of antipsychotic drugs needs to be protected by hepatoprotective medications. This study evaluated the antiinflammatory effect of N-acetylcysteine (NAC) and Royal jelly against hepatotoxicity of fluoxetine in rats. Methods: Thirty adult female rats were divided into five equal groups of 6 rats. Group A was considered negative control. Group B were rats administered orally by fluoxetine (10 mg\kg) to induce hepatotoxicity. Group C were animals pre-treated with oral NAC (200 mg\kg) and then fluoxetine (10 mg\kg). Group D was pre-treated with Royal jelly (150 mg\kg) following the use of fluoxetine (10 mg\kg). Group E was pretreated with oral Royal jelly and NAC following fluoxetine utilization. After completion of 28 days of treatment, the rats were euthanized and a blood sample was collected and evaluated for inflammatory cytokines of tumor necrotizing factor alpha (TNF-α), interleukin-10 (IL10) and oxidative stress biomarkers of malondialdehyde (MDA) and glutathione (GSH) by ELISA. Results: Fluoxetine induced hepatotoxicity and an increase in inflammatory cytokines such as TNF-α. Royal jelly and NAC showed significant anti-inflammatory and antioxidant effects by reduction in inflammatory cytokines and oxidative parameters. Conclusion: Both NAC and Royall jelly were shown to have antioxidant and anti-inflammatory activities, even NAC impact was more than Royal jelly against hepato toxicity induced by fluoxetine. | ||
